The Vehicle Whiplash Protection Systems Market is expanding as automakers intensify focus on occupant safety and impact injury mitigation technologies. Whiplash protection systems are designed to minimize neck and spinal injuries during rear-end collisions by optimizing seat geometry, head restraint positioning, and energy absorption mechanisms.  


Stringent global crash safety regulations, rising consumer awareness of post-collision injury risks, and advancements in intelligent seat systems are accelerating adoption across passenger vehicles. Manufacturers are integrating active head restraints and crash-responsive seat designs to enhance protection and meet evolving automotive safety standards.  


When accident happens whiplash injury occurs in person’s neck due to sudden acceleration deceleration force when accident happens. Whiplash is also known as neck sprain or neck strain caused due to soft tissue injury in the neck. Airbags and seatbelts can minimize the risk of injury in case of an accident. But, car manufacturers are focusing more on the other passive safety systems like occupant sensing and whiplash protection. The whiplash Protection System was introduced by Volvo in 1998.  


In this system, special seat is designed to support spinal with modified backrest. WHIPS is used to help in rear-end collision, where the angle and speed of the collision and the nature of the colliding vehicle have an influence on driver and front seat passenger. When WHIPS is deployed, the front seat backrests are move to backward direction and the seat cushions move downward to change the seating position to reduce risk of whiplash injury. WHIPS equipped seat have reduced whiplash injuries caused by car accidents to great extent.  


But WHIPS are generally provided in luxury vehicles due to extremely budget conscious nature of the car buyers. With this much budget it becomes difficult for manufacturers to add such costly systems into the cars. Therefore they give first priority to the air bags and abs systems. But growing safety awareness and tighter safety regulations will boost the market for whiplash protection systems over the forecast period.  


Currently, Europe is the largest market for occupant sensing system and whiplash protection system. In upcoming years, US is expected to show positive growth in the occupant sensing system and whiplash protection system market. In developing countries of the Asia-Pacific region such as China, India factors such as strict safety regulations by governments, growing awareness for automotive safety technologies, increasing vehicle sales & safety installations per vehicles are accelerating the demand for automotive occupant sensing system and whiplash protection system.
